    Three notes to watch…
    Penn State head coach James Franklin has called for “White Out energy” for Saturday night’s top 25 showdown. No matter what the weather calls for, expect the environment at Beaver Stadium to be a tough place to play on Saturday.

    The Fighting Illini team are battle tested on the road after winning in overtime against Nebraska at Memorial Stadium, one of the toughest places to play in the Big 10. However, Illinois head coach Bret Bielema’s viral comments on Monday certainly could give the Penn State fans a chip on their shoulder.

    “I don’t know if they’re going to be in blue and white or whatever they’re going to be in this weekend. They’re going to be dressed, right? It’s probably going to be one or the other,” Bielema said. “They’re going to be calling for “Whiteout Energy. Whatever the hell that means.”

    Will Penn State defensive coordinator Tom Allen be on the sideline or the booth?

    The former Indiana head coach began the season on the sidelines for the Nittany Lions but moved upstairs after the Bowling Green game, where the defense immensely struggled in the first half. Despite being asked questions about it, Franklin has not made a public decision yet on where Allen will be.

    Will the real Luke Altmyer please stand up?

    The Illinois quarterback threw four interceptions and was benched in last year’s loss to Penn State. Through the first four weeks this season, Altmyer has emerged as one of the most improved players in the Big 10. Altmyer has passed for 10 touchdowns this season and has thrown no interceptions.
